Where to Be Cautious With the Design

While the Elegant Floral Ornament Pattern is visually striking, there are areas where it might not perform as well. On thin or stretchy fabrics, the detail could get lost or distort during stitching. Similarly, dark fabrics may not show the design as clearly, depending on thread color choices.

Small hoop sizes could be a challenge. If the design is too large for the hoop, it might result in gaps or misalignment. Textured or layered garments could also cause issues, as the stitches might not sit flat. For curved surfaces like caps, the design may need some adjustment to ensure it looks good when stitched.

Another consideration is stitch density. If the design is too dense, it could lead to puckering or stiffness, especially on delicate fabrics. I’d recommend testing it on scrap fabric before committing to a final project. Also, if the design includes tiny lettering or detailed corners, those areas should be closely inspected for clarity.

Practical Designer Notes for Using the Pattern

Before using the Elegant Floral Ornament Pattern in a project, I always recommend testing it on a scrap piece of fabric. This helps identify any issues with stitch density, stabilizer needs, or thread color contrast. For example, if the design is meant for dark fabric, you’ll want to choose a thread color that stands out clearly.

Check the hoop size required for the design. If it’s too large, consider breaking it into sections or adjusting the layout. Also, review the file formats provided—EPS, JPEG, SVG, PNG, AI, and PDF offer flexibility for different uses, whether for print, digital assets, or embroidery machines.

If the design includes applique or satin stitch elements, make sure the fabric can handle those techniques. For commercial projects, confirm the licensing terms to avoid any legal issues. And don’t forget to use the right stabilizer for the fabric type, especially on delicate or stretchy materials.
